美文网首页
PHP+MySQL实现最简单的增删改查

PHP+MySQL实现最简单的增删改查

作者: G加号 | 来源:发表于2024-03-03 11:45 被阅读0次

    1.SQL查询(SELECT):

    <?php
    $servername = "localhost"; // MySQL服务器名称或IP地址
    $username = "root";       // MySQL用户名
    $password = "";           // MySQL密码
    $dbname = "myDB";         // 要连接的数据库名称
     
    // 创建与MySQL数据库的连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
     
    // 编写SQL查询语句
    $sql = "SELECT * FROM myTable";
     
    // 执行查询并获取结果集
    $result = $conn->query($sql);
     
    // 处理结果集
    if ($result->num_rows > 0) {
        while($row = $result->fetch_assoc()) {
            echo "ID: " . $row["id"]. ", Name: " . $row["name"]. "<br>";
        }
    } else {
        echo "No results found.";
    }
     
    // 关闭数据库连接
    $conn->close();
    ?>
    

    2.SQL插入(INSERT):

    <?php
    $servername = "localhost";   // MySQL服务器名称或IP地址
    $username = "root";          // MySQL用户名
    $password = "";              // MySQL密码
    $dbname = "myDB";            // 要连接的数据库名称
     
    // 创建与MySQL数据库的连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
     
    // 编写SQL插入语句
    $sql = "INSERT INTO myTable (name, age) VALUES ('John', '30')";
     
    // 执行插入操作
    if ($conn->query($sql) === TRUE) {
        echo "New record created successfully!";
    } else {
        echo "Error: " . $sql . "<br>" . $conn->error;
    }
     
    // 关闭数据库连接
    $conn->close();
    ?>
    

    3.SQL更新(UPDATE):

    <?php
    $servername = "localhost";   // MySQL服务器名称或IP地址
    $username = "root";          // MySQL用户名
    $password = "";              // MySQL密码
    $dbname = "myDB";            // 要连接的数据库名称
     
    // 创建与MySQL数据库的连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
     
    // 编写SQL更新语句
    $sql = "UPDATE myTable SET name='Jane' WHERE id=1";
     
    // 执行更新操作
    if ($conn->query($sql) === TRUE) {
        echo "Record updated successfully!";
    } else {
        echo "Error updating record: " . $conn->error;
    }
     
    // 关闭数据库连接
    $conn->close();
    ?>
    

    4.SQL删除(DELETE):

    <?php
    $servername = "localhost"; // 数据库服务器名称
    $username = "your_username"; // 数据库用户名
    $password = "your_password"; // 数据库密码
    $dbname = "your_database"; // 数据库名称
     
    // 创建与数据库的连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
    //编写SQL语句来执行删除操作。根据需求选择合适的条件来指定要删除的记录。
    //your_table应该被替换为要从其中删除记录的表格名称,
    //而condition则是指定要删除的记录的条件。
    $sql = "DELETE FROM your_table WHERE condition";
    if ($conn->query($sql) === TRUE) {
        echo "Record deleted successfully.";
    } else {
        echo "Error deleting record: " . $conn->error;
    }
    //最后,断开与数据库的连接。
    $conn->close();
    ?>
    

    相关文章

      网友评论

          本文标题:PHP+MySQL实现最简单的增删改查

          本文链接:https://www.haomeiwen.com/subject/icvkzdtx.html